Pittsburgh police give away gun locks after accidental shootings involving kids

Pittsburgh police are giving away free gun locks at all zone stations and police headquarters while supplies last.

Pittsburgh police are offering free gun locks in an effort to combat accidental shootings after two children were killed in separate incidents on Monday.

The gun locks are available at the six zone stations as well as police headquarters on the city’s North Side.

“Taking five to 10 minutes to place the lock on a gun could potentially save a life,” said Public Safety Director Wendell Hissrich. “That’s what we’re trying to get out to the public today – that these locks are available.”

Two children died in apparent accidental shootings on Monday. A 4-year-old in East Liberty died shortly before 9 a.m. after, police said, he seems to have accidentally shot himself in the face with an unsecured gun.

Less than 12 hours later, a 6-year-old shot their 5-year-old brother at a home in Penn Hills. Allegheny County Police have said three children were playing unsupervised in a bedroom of the Prescott Drive home where there was an unsecured gun.

Police said the gun appears to be legally owned by a parent, who is cooperating with the investigation.

Pittsburgh authorities called gun locks a crucial part of curbing accidental shootings, particularly by children. The locks work by lacing through the magazine chamber into the ejection port before locking into place.

Hissrich urged gun owners to keep their firearms away from children or locked in a secure place.
